Job DescriptionThis role reports to a Senior Property Manager and has responsibility for the operation and maintenance of a portfolio of mixed used commercial properties and strategies and to deliver the best revenue outcomes to Aramark Property for carrying out this service.
The portfolio will be predominantly retail and office properties.The candidate will be required to generally maintain constant awareness of the importance of the clients' corporate image and the role of on-site management and presentation in achieving that objective.Job ResponsibilitiesReporting to the Senior Property Manager on the status of the properties under your remit on a weekly basisPrepare and handle service charge budgets, analyze variances and take corrective actions where vital.Ensure that operational standards at properties meet the clients' requirements.Inspect and arrange for maintenance and repairs to meet standards on time and within budget including implementation of Planned Preventative Maintenance measures.Ensure that all health & safety practices and procedures are actioned, and clients are kept advised of risks as appropriate.Ensure that rents and service charges are paid to meet clients' financial objectives and collaborate closely with tenants, finance team, client, and solicitors as necessary.Negotiate contracts with contractors following the procurement process and ensure that invoices are approved on time.Lead the performance of on-site personnel.Report periodically on performance both operational and financial as the need arises by the client.Ensure that critical dates e.g.
lease renewal, rent review, break clauses are advised to clients in a timely fashion.Develop and integrate Sustainability standard methodologies/ accreditations where vital and work with the existing team to drive client sustainability initiatives including GRESB, LEED, WELL etcProperties managed, and Clients serviced can be altered from time to time in response to changing the changing requirements of the Aramark Property business.Be involved in new business pitches and consultancy services and advices to a variety of clients.Establish and nurture constructive and positive relationships with tenants and members of the public and occupiersImplement Planned Preventative Maintenance measures as is required that have been identified by a building surveySupport Aramark Property in preparing and presenting proposals for new work.
The role will include senior level interaction with clients, banks, and receivers.Instigate and manage opportunities for business development and additional income sourcesNote: Due to the nature of the business additional duties may be assigned from time to time.Qualifications4 to 8 years' experience in commercial/ retail Property ManagementHave an appropriate third level degree and/or professional qualification –MRICS or equivalentExcellent communicator who can work individually and as part of a team Ability to work on your own but you are also a great teammate Flexible approach and dynamic personality comfortable in a multifaceted and sophisticated business environmentAre solution Focused and inventiveHave the ability to negotiate with and influence third parties; tenants, contractors, clientsAre computer literate in word, excel, PowerPointTechnically familiar with the management of portfolio of mixed property uses.Able to proactively manage clients, tenants, contractors, and other partners Able to report to clients in a clear, comprehensive, and concise manner Must hold a clean driving licenseEducationAbout AramarkNorthern Europe - Our MissionRooted in service and united by our purpose, we strive to do great things for each other, our partners, our communities, and our planet.Northern Europe - About AramarkAramark is a leading service and solutions provider in Northern Europe.
